Mary Hersom was born circa 1756.2 She was the daughter of Benjamin Hersom and Mary Jones.2 Mary Hersom went by the nick-name of Molly.2 As of 15 August 1774,her married name was Lord.1,2
Mary Hersom married Simeon Lord, age 23 , son of Elder Ebenezer Lord and Martha Emery, on 15 August 1774 at Berwick, Province of Massachusetts Bay (Maine). They had no children.1,2 Mary Hersom was mentioned in the will of Simeon Lord on 22 January 1813 receiving the estate for her lifetime, after which it was to go to his nephew, James Lord.2 Mary Hersom died on 10 June 1831 at Lebanon, Maine.2
